Professional Gutter Cleaning Service – Protect Your Home from Water Damage

Clogged gutters are more than just an eyesore—they can cause serious structural damage to your home. Leaves, twigs, and debris block proper water drainage, leading to overflow, roof leaks, foundation cracks, and even basement flooding. Our professional gutter cleaning service ensures your gutters are free-flowing and fully functional, safeguarding your home from costly water-related issues.

Why Gutter Cleaning is Essential

✔ Prevents Costly Water Damage

  • Clogged gutters cause overflow, leading to roof leaks, rotting fascia, and damaged siding.

  • Avoid foundation erosion and basement flooding by directing water away from your home.

✔ Stops Mold & Mildew Growth

  • Standing water in gutters promotes mold, algae, and wood rot, compromising your home’s structure.

✔ Protects Your Roof & Landscaping

  • Excess water weight can warp gutters and damage shingles.

  • Prevents soil erosion and protects flower beds, mulch, and walkways.

✔ Deters Pests & Insects

  • Clogged gutters attract mosquitoes, rodents, birds, and termites looking for nesting spots.

✔ Extends Gutter Lifespan

  • Regular cleaning prevents rust, corrosion, and sagging, saving you money on replacements.

Our Thorough Gutter Cleaning Process

We don’t just remove debris—we restore optimal gutter function:

  1. Inspection – Check for damage, leaks, or sagging sections.

  2. Debris Removal – Hand-clearing leaves, twigs, and sludge.

  3. Flushing Downspouts – Ensuring water flows freely without blockages.

  4. Checking Alignment – Adjusting gutters for proper drainage.

  5. Final Check – Confirming no clogs remain before we leave.

Signs You Need Gutter Cleaning

✔ Water spilling over gutter edges
✔ Plants or weeds growing in gutters
✔ Sagging or pulling away from the roofline
✔ Staining on siding or foundation
✔ Visible debris buildup

What surfaces can you safely clean without causing damage?

We clean a wide range of surfaces — including concrete, pavers, tiles, weatherboards, Colourbond, brick, render, and more. For delicate materials, we use soft washing techniques that rely on cleaning solutions instead of high pressure to avoid damage.

How often should I get my property professionally cleaned?

It depends on your property and environment, but most clients benefit from a professional clean every 6–12 months. Regular maintenance not only keeps your property looking sharp — it also prevents long-term damage, saves you money, and preserves its value.

Will pressure washing damage my paint, windows, or roof?

Not at all — when done professionally. We adjust our pressure levels and use the appropriate method for each surface. Roofs, render and painted areas are typically cleaned using soft washing, which is gentle yet effective.

Will the chemicals you use harm my plants or landscaping?

That’s a common concern — and we completely understand. While we use professional-grade solutions (including chlorine-based treatments for mold, algae, and stains), we take extra precautions to protect your plants and garden areas. We always pre-wet surrounding vegetation before we begin, rinse throughout the process, and thoroughly rinse everything again after the wash. This greatly dilutes any chemical exposure, helping ensure your plants remain healthy and unharmed. Our team is trained to work carefully around landscaping, and we treat your home like it’s our own.
